繁体   English   中英

将__NSCFNumber转换为Int32 Swift

[英]Convert __NSCFNumber to Int32 Swift

我在Parse.com上有一个数据库设置,其中一个列的类型为Number。 当我从Parse中提取数据时,我收到的错误是我无法将__NSCFNumber转换为Int32。

var index = word["index"] as! Int32

我似乎无法在任何地方找到任何解决方案,有人可以告诉我将__NSCFNumber类型转换为Int32的正确方法是什么?

谢谢!

__NSCFNumber是子类NSNumber 要从NSNumber获取整数,可以使用其integerValue属性:

var index: Int32 = word["index"].integerValue

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M